CRIHB has been awarded a $280,000 grant from the California Wellness Foundation for the Dr. Phillip R. Lee Scholarship Program to support American Indian students pursuing health careers. Scholarships are distributed twice a year. Applications are reviewed and awarded by the CRIHB Scholarship Committee which is made up of CRIHB Board of Director's.
The Native American health care professional care giver is in high demand because the Native American population still has the worst health statistics in the nation and many live on Indian Reservations in remote parts of California that are not attractive to people that do not have any ties to the Indian Communities. CRIHB has twelve (12) Member Tribal Health Programs that serves over 66,000 Indian patients at 28 Indian Health Clinic sites. The IHS Scholarship is for students interested in, or who are presently in, health realted preparatory or professional academic programs. In order to have a completed IHS Scholarship Application, students should use the list on the "Application Checklist" form, under NEW in the Application Information Instruction Booklet.
